E-ICE仿真器对比分析:从HT-ICE到新一代仿真工具

需积分: 16 1 下载量 115 浏览量 更新于2024-07-21 1 收藏 2.39MB PPT 举报
"本文介绍了合泰单片机Holtek的E-ICE仿真器,对比了其与HT-ICE的区别,涵盖了电源与接口、仿真效果、断点设置、刻录支持和追踪模式等方面。" E-ICE仿真器是Holtek公司推出的一款先进的单片机仿真工具,相较于旧款的HT-ICE,E-ICE在多个方面有所提升和优化。首先,E-ICE在硬件连接上更加便捷,它采用了USB接口与个人计算机(PC)相连,不再需要打印机并口线和额外的电源adapter,简化了用户的使用步骤。 在仿真效果方面,E-ICE的显著优势在于其Realchip架构,能够适应所仿真集成电路(IC)的全工作电压范围,无论是3.3V还是5.0V,甚至更多,使得仿真结果更加接近实际IC的工作状态。而HT-ICE则只能在3.3V或5.0V下工作,适用性相对较窄。 在计数能力上,E-ICE的cyclecount支持4bytes,远超HT-ICE的2bytes,这意味着E-ICE在处理复杂计算和控制任务时,能够提供更为精确的周期计数信息。 在断点设置上,E-ICE虽然不能在freerun模式下设置断点,但它取消了断点数量的限制,用户可以在PROM中设置任意数量的断点,而HT-ICE仅允许设置3个断点,且可以在RAM中设置。这一差异表明E-ICE在调试大型程序时可能更具优势。 在程序烧录功能上,HT-ICE内置了刻录接口,可以直接配合K1000进行烧录操作,而E-ICE则没有内置此功能,需要使用额外的刻录器完成该过程,这可能增加了用户的设备投入成本,但也使得E-ICE设计更为紧凑。 在追踪模式上,HT-ICE提供了更丰富的选择,包括normal模式、INT和Main程序的单独追踪,还具备Trigger和Qualify功能,适合需要深度调试的场合。相比之下,E-ICE的追踪模式较为基础,只能选择normal模式,缺乏高级的触发和合格条件设置,可能更适合简单的调试需求。 E-ICE仿真器在便携性、电压适应性、计数能力和断点管理上都有所改进,但在刻录功能和高级追踪模式上略显不足。用户应根据具体项目的需求和调试复杂度来选择合适的仿真器。对于需要广泛电压支持和灵活断点设置的开发者,E-ICE可能是更优的选择;而对于需要复杂追踪功能和现场烧录的用户,HT-ICE可能更适合。